Where Do Online Casinos Operate?
From a technical standpoint an online casino can be set up to operate almost anywhere on the planet. All that you require to set up a profitable web-based casino are an internet connection, server(s), gambling software, and a attractively designed web page, not any of these is hard to acquire. Nevertheless; just because you can [...]
From a technical standpoint an online casino can be set up to operate almost anywhere on the planet. All that you require to set up a profitable web-based casino are an internet connection, server(s), gambling software, and a attractively designed web page, not any of these is hard to acquire. Nevertheless; just because you can [...]



